Output 20b94226aa5a02d13eb11093e3ba5c4989ee9e776e11295580f440eaebd421d6:0

value
4287821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c76ee3fb89620c324877b07330ef693c94e99c0 OP_EQUAL
address
34HXKMxQzo1XjSYSR14ta8bD4aH1UpM81u
transaction
20b94226aa5a02d13eb11093e3ba5c4989ee9e776e11295580f440eaebd421d6
spent
false

2 Sat Ranges